критически важный вопрос для организаций, полагающихся на Как осуществляется нетрадиционные системы данных. В отличие от стандартных реляционных баз данных, которые часто используют единообразные инструменты Как осуществляется резервного копирования, специальные базы данных требуют уникальных стратегий, адаптированных к их архитектурам и моделям данных. Каждый тип специальной базы данных — будь то графовая, документоориентированная, временная или распределенная — поставляется со своими собственными методами обеспечения безопасности и восстановления данных.
Стратегии резервного копирования в графовых базах данных
Графовые базы данных, такие как Neo4j, требуют решений для резервного копирования, которые могут сохранять как узлы, так и их сложные связи. Эти базы данных часто предоставляют данные vnpay собственные инструменты резервного копирования, такие как neo4j-admin backup
команда Neo4j, которая поддерживает полное и инкрементальное резервное копирование. Некоторые также предлагают онлайн-резервное копирование, которое не нарушает живые запросы. Резервное копирование должно быть согласованным, чтобы поддерживать целостность путей графа, что делает подходы на основе снимков особенно популярными в этих средах.
Обработка резервных копий в базах данных документов
Базы данных документов, такие как MongoDB, используют структуры документов, подобные JSON, и извлекают выгоду из собственных и сторонних решений для резервного копирования. MongoDB Какие языки запросов используют специальные базы данных предлагает такие функции, как mongodump
и mongorestore
для ручного резервного копирования, а также Atlas для автоматизированного облачного резервного копирования. Восстановление на определенный момент времени, репликация на основе oplog и запланированные снимки помогают управлять долговечностью и целостностью данных в динамических системах хранения документов.
Базы данных временных рядов и непрерывные снимки
Базы данных временных рядов, такие как InfluxDB, управляют резервным копированием, фокусируясь на высокоскоростных записях и хранении на основе времени. Такие инструменты, как influx backup
позволяют Цифры Италии выполнять полное или частичное резервное копирование измерений и метаданных. Многие также полагаются на непрерывные моментальные снимки и журналы предварительной записи для фиксации изменений данных. Политики хранения и понижение выборки часто минимизируют потребности в хранении, обеспечивая баланс между глубиной резервного копирования и производительностью.
Базы данных с широкими столбцами и распределенные снимки
Базы данных с! широкими! столбцами! такие! как Apache Cassandra! распределяют! данные по нескольким! узлам! что требует! скоординированных! усилий по! резервному! копированию. Они часто! используют! такие инструменты! как nodetool snapshot
создание согласованных резервных копий на уровне узлов. Эти снимки обычно хранятся локально или отправляются в облачные системы хранения. Из-за распределенной природы баз данных с широкими столбцами системы резервного копирования должны обеспечивать согласованность на уровне кластера, чтобы обеспечить эффективное восстановление.